FalconX is a pioneering institutional digital asset platform that has facilitated over $1 trillion in client transactions. The company operates at the intersection of traditional finance and cryptocurrency, providing trade execution, credit and treasury management, prime offering, and market-making services to institutional clients.
FalconX Bravo, Inc. is a registered Swap Dealer seeking an experienced Chief Compliance Officer to lead the compliance function. This role reports to senior management and the Board of Directors, overseeing all aspects of the Swap Dealer Compliance Program under CFTC, NFA, and Federal Reserve Board regulations.
Key responsibilities include: advising on and implementing enhancements to the Swap Dealer Compliance Program; managing policies, procedures, and controls; responding to regulatory inquiries, audits, and examinations from the CFTC and NFA; managing non-compliance incidents and remediation; developing and conducting periodic testing of internal controls; creating and delivering swap dealer compliance training to relevant personnel; managing conflicts of interest; and providing regular reporting to management and the Board.
The ideal candidate brings 10+ years of legal or compliance experience, preferably from an investment or commercial bank, law firm, consulting firm, or regulatory organization. Demonstrated experience implementing and executing a swap dealer compliance program at a registered swap dealer is essential. Strong understanding of the Dodd-Frank Act and associated swap dealer regulations is required, along with direct experience interacting with the CFTC, NFA, and FRB. Familiarity with OTC derivatives trading, particularly foreign exchange and interest rate derivatives, is important. The role requires managing teams across geographical regions, excellent communication skills, and the ability to handle multiple complex projects simultaneously. A bachelor's degree or equivalent experience in compliance, legal, or control functions in financial services is required.
